“…Quantification of C1-oxidized dimers and trimers (GlcGlc1A and Glc 2 Glc1A) was performed using high-performance anion exchange chromatography with pulsed amperometric detection (HPAEC-PAD), using a 26 min gradient as described previously. 49 HPAEC-PAD was performed with a Dionex ICS6000 (Thermo Fisher Scientific, Waltham, MA, USA) equipped with a 1 × 250 mm Dionex CarboPac PA-200 analytical column attached to 1 × 50 mm Dionex CarboPac PA-200 guard column. The operational flow was at 63 μL/min, and 4 μL samples were injected.…”
